 +====Standard series cons==== 
 +  * Supporting professional development need larger pin count than 24 pins 
 +  * The two 12pin 2.54 pitch Connectors can't support modular or Scalable development 
 +  * Any not trivial use case can end-up to a mesh of cables and bad connections 
 +  ​* The missing ​link was a good quality dense and low profile connector 
 + 
 +====n-PRO==== 
 +    * Same board dimensions and mounting holes as the standard series 
 +    * 240 pins connectivity spread in Four Hirose DF30-series 60-pin low profile connectors 
 +    * Has backwards form factor compatibility  
 +    * Scalable integration in simple way  
 +    * Prototyping is Fast, Modular No cables, looks good  
 +    * Mirror connectors: To connect additional fucntionality like RF, Sensors etc.All the motherboards have these connectors. 
 + 
 +====Host and Peripheral concept==== 
 +  * CPU boards are HOST 
 +  * Sensor boards are peripheral 
 +  * DAP programming / mbed-enable boards are peripheral 
 +  * Development boards are Peripheral 
 +  * Application boards are Peripheral
